After nearly 30 years, a mystery death in Olympic National Park has been solved thanks to groundbreaking DNA testing. The skeletal remains found in a tent in 2000 were identified as Joseph Louis Serrao Jr., who vanished from Hawaii in 1998. Despite no fingerprints and no leads for decades, modern forensic science finally brought closure to his family — proving that persistence and technology can solve even the longest cold cases.
